Eisler Capital Management Ltd. Takes Position in Canadian National Railway (NYSE:CNI)

Canadian National Railway logo with Transportation background

Eisler Capital Management Ltd. purchased a new position in shares of Canadian National Railway (NYSE:CNI - Free Report) TSE: CNR during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und purchased 149,772 shares of the transportation company's stock, valued at approximately $15,270,000. Canadian National Railway accounts for about 0.1% of Eisler Capital Management Ltd.'s holdings, making the stock its 13th largest position.

Canadian National Railway Price Performance

Shares of NYSE:CNI traded up $1.59 during trading on Wednesday, reaching $106.79. The company had a trading volume of 787,603 shares, compared to its average volume of 1,304,086. The firm's fifty day moving average is $98.22 and its 200 day moving average is $102.57. The firm has a market capitalization of $67.12 billion, a PE ratio of 20.86,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.95 and a beta of 0.97. Canadian National Railway has a twelve month low of $91.65 and a twelve month high of $129.18.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.94, a quick ratio of 0.48 and a current ratio of 0.66.

Canadian National Railway (NYSE:CNI - Get Free Report) TSE: CNR last released its earnings results on Thursday, May 1st. The transportation company reported $1.29 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$1.26 by $0.03. Canadian National Railway had a net margin of 26.09% and a return on equity of 22.48%. The business had revenue of $3.06 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$4.38 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$1.72 EPS. The business's revenue for the quarter was up 3.6% on a year-over-year basis. On average, equities analysts forecast that Canadian National Railway will post 5.52 EPS for the current year.

Canadian National Railway Profile

(Free Report)

Canadian National Railway Company,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the rail, intermodal, trucking, and marine transportation and logistics business in Canada and the United States. The company provides rail services, which include equipment, custom brokerage services, transloading and distribution, business development and real estate, and private car storage services; and intermodal services, such as temperature controlled cargo, port partnerships, and logistics parks.
